Stocks Screener

Specify a stock or a cryptocurrency in the search bar to get a summary

Internet Computer ICP
Bitcoin Cash BCH
Litecoin LTC
Field stub for analysis

John Bean Technologies Corporation

JBT
Current price
110 EUR -2 EUR (-1.79%)
Last closed 117.75 USD
ISIN US4778391049
Sector Industrials
Industry Specialty Industrial Machinery
Exchange Frankfurt Exchange
Capitalization 3 707 115 520 USD
Yield for 12 month +8.84 %
1Y
3Y
5Y
10Y
15Y
JBT
21.11.2021 - 28.11.2021

John Bean Technologies Corporation provides technology solutions to food and beverage industry in North America, Europe, the Middle East, Africa, the Asia Pacific, and Latin America. It offers value-added processing that includes chilling, mixing/grinding, injecting, blending, marinating, tumbling, flattening, forming, portioning, coating, cooking, frying, freezing, extracting, pasteurizing, sterilizing, concentrating, high pressure processing, weighing, inspecting, filling, closing, sealing, end of line material handling, and packaging solutions to the food, beverage, and health market. In addition, it offers automated guided vehicle systems for material movement in the manufacturing, warehouse, and medical facilities. It serves baby food, bakery and confectionery, citrus processing, fruits and nuts, juices, non-food, pet food, pharmaceutical, plant- based beverages and protein, poultry, meat, and seafood, ready meals, oils, soups, sauces, seasoning and dressings, automotive, building material, tissue, paper, and packaging, hospitals, pharma and life sciences, fast moving consumer goods, manufacturing, warehousing, and other industries. The company markets and sells its products and solutions through direct sales force, independent distributors, sales representatives, and technical service teams. John Bean Technologies Corporation was incorporated in 1994 and is headquartered in Chicago, Illinois. Address: 70 West Madison Street, Chicago, IL, United States, 60602

Check your investment idea

Find the best to beat the market
TSLA TSLA Tesla Motors
AAPL AAPL Apple
MSFT MSFT Microsoft

Analytics

WallStreet Target Price

117 USD

P/E ratio

26.0447

Dividend Yield

0.34 %

Current Year

+1 664 400 000 USD

Last Year

+2 166 000 000 USD

Current Quarter

+453 800 000 USD

Last Quarter

+403 100 000 USD

Current Year

+585 700 000 USD

Last Year

+617 300 000 USD

Current Quarter

+163 600 000 USD

Last Quarter

+145 700 001 USD

Key Figures JBT

1 year
3 years
5 years
10 years
21.11.2021 - 28.11.2021
EBITDA 266 600 000 USD
Operating Margin TTM 12.89 %
PE Ratio 26.0447
Return On Assets TTM 4.39 %
PEG Ratio 1.2201
Return On Equity TTM 9.75 %
Wall Street Target Price 117 USD
Revenue TTM 1 692 999 936 USD
Book Value 49.78 USD
Revenue Per Share TTM
Dividend Share 0.4 USD
Quarterly Revenue Growth YOY 12.4 %
Dividend Yield 0.34 %
Gross Profit TTM 617 500 000 USD
Earnings per share 4.47 USD
Diluted Eps TTM 4.47 USD
Most Recent Quarter III 2024
Quarterly Earnings Growth YOY -91.2 %
Profit Margin 10.25 %

Dividend Analytics JBT

Dividend growth over 5 years

Continuous growth

1 year

Payout Ratio 5 years average

9 %

Dividend History JBT

1 year
3 years
5 years
10 years
21.11.2021 - 28.11.2021
Forward Annual Dividend Rate 0.4
Ex Dividend Date 19.08.2024
Forward Annual Dividend Yield 0.34 %
Last Split Factor
Payout Ratio 8.33 %
Last Split Date
Dividend Date 03.09.2024

Stock Valuation JBT

1 year
3 years
5 years
10 years
21.11.2021 - 28.11.2021
Trailing PE 26.0447
Forward PE 20.6612
Enterprise Value Revenue 2.2569
Price Sales TTM 2.1897
Enterprise Value EBITDA 14.2999
Price Book MRQ 2.3387

Financials JBT

1 year
3 years
5 years
10 years
15 years
Results 2019 Dynamics
* The data for this period has not yet been published

Technical indicators JBT

For 52 weeks

82.64 USD 122.9 USD
50 Day MA 102.49 USD
Shares Short Prior Month 2 020 425
200 Day MA 97.34 USD
Short Ratio 7.13
Shares Short 2 577 483
Short Percent 11.3 %